Another Gear Question
I have a 88 4runner 22RE w/ 35's and 4.10's. I can barely use 5th gear on flat roads and I'm sick of it.. What I've read so far is for a DD with 35's you wanna run 4.88's. The thing is I will be downgrading to 33's within the next year, but I want to do gears now. My question is how will I like 4.56's and 33's for a DD? Will I be able to use 5th gear and get better gas mileage? Thanks for you input..

You will see a minor increase in both running 33's on 4.56's. 4.88's are the correct ratio for the tire size you wanna run. I'd go with the '88's. 4.56's are for 31's.....
